Early Roots in Financial Writing

Mucklai’s exploration of publishing and digital reach began early in life. At age 15, he started writing about investing and financial markets. Within a year, he was contributing financial analysis to Seeking Alpha and Nasdaq, and his work eventually appeared across more than 25 major publications, including Forbes. These early writing endeavors provided firsthand insight into public perception, credibility, online information reach, and opportunity.

He later pursued formal finance training at The University of Texas at Dallas, earning his degree in 2017. As an undergraduate, he gained practical experience across prominent financial institutions and Fortune 500 companies, including Fidelity Investments, BlackRocks, Texas Instruments, and AIG. After graduation, he took a position at Goldman Sachs, where his responsibilities touched upon investment banking and private equity.

Pivoting toward the legal sector, Mucklai enrolled at Southwestern Law School in Los Angeles, completing his Juris Doctor in 2023. During his legal studies, he completed a semester with the Los Angeles District Attorney’s Office. Together, his legal and financial training equipped him with a thorough understanding of corporate structures, financial strategy, contracts, regulation, and risk management.

Transitioning from Public Relations to Tech Innovation

Following law school, Mucklai built and scaled a public relations firm to seven figures. Through this venture, he noticed a constant barrier for growing businesses and creators: securing meaningful attention. While large corporations enjoy dedicated communications teams, vast marketing budgets, and built-in media contacts, smaller organizations frequently struggle to distribute their stories effectively.

Convinced that technology could dismantle this barrier, Mucklai combined his varied experiences across media, public relations, technology, entrepreneurship, law, finance, and investment banking to create Imperium AI. His technical skillset—including familiarity with Laravel, PHP, WordPress, and HTML—allows him to navigate both the strategic and technical sides of building digital platforms.

Outside of his ventures, Mucklai is also multilingual. He is fluent in English, Hindi, and Urdu, possesses conversational proficiency in Spanish and Hebrew, and can read Arabic.
